Mumbai Indians beat CSK by 37 runs

Mumbai, (PTI) Mumbai Indians beat Chennai Super Kings by 37 runs in the Indian Premier League here Wednesday.

Sent into bat, Mumbai Indians scored 170 for five at the Wankhede Stadium and restricted CSK to 133 for eight in 20 overs.

Brief scores:

Mumbai Indians: 170/5 in 20 overs (Suryakumar Yadav 59, Krunal Pandya 42, Hardik Pandya 25 not out).

Chennai Super Kings: 133/8 in 20 overs (Kedar Jadhav 58; Hardik Pandya 3/20, Lasith Malinga 3/34; Jason Behrendorff 2/22).
